## Tuning Sentrybark

Sentrybark scans incoming package names against the Corvel registry for typo-squat candidates. On-call engineers should understand the tradeoff before changing anything: lower distance thresholds catch more squats but flood the review queue; shorter scan intervals raise registry load noticeably. Always change one constant at a time and watch the `squat_review_backlog` gauge for an hour afterward. The constants ship with these defaults.

tuning constants:
QUOTAS = {
    "druwyn": 5,
    "holix": 5,
    "zorath": 5,
    "holwyn": 10,
}

Subject: SproutCycle cut-over done

Hey — quick wrap-up for your review. We moved the SproutCycle watering scheduler off the old Fernwick box to the new cluster last night. Zero missed watering windows, auth now goes through the Trellis broker, and the legacy cron creds were revoked this morning. For your audit checklist, here are the live config values as deployed:

deployment values, kajep-kageg:
[praix]
host = praix.paliqcorp.corp
user = praix_svc
database = praix_prod

## Deployment

Remindlet is the little job that pings Harrowgate Clinic patients about upcoming appointments. It runs as a scheduled worker on the Fennick cluster, once every fifteen minutes during clinic hours. Deploys go through the usual pipeline — push to main, wait for the smoke tests, then promote. Heads up: the reminder window and SMS throttle are config-driven, not hardcoded, so don't go hunting in the source. Before promoting, double-check the worker picks up the values shown below.

deployment values, yadug-bawif:
[framir]
team = pelox
access_code = ac_a38ab2
owner = tamion.julael
host = framir.tolvaqlabs.test
port = 11211
peer = tammir.zemvargrid.local
salt = 2215ef03
pin = 1541

## Key Ceremony Checklist — Item 7: TilePrefetch

Support: TilePrefetch warms map tiles for the Farrowmap mobile app ahead of commuter hours. Its signing key rotates during the quarterly ceremony. Confirm the prefetch queue is drained, the Brindlehall staging region is paused, and two ceremony witnesses have signed the log. Then open the sealed ceremony envelope workflow in the console. When prompted, you will need the recovery passphrase, which is recorded directly below this item.

strongbox words: ralys-druiel-ulaix-isteth-rusath-kelmir-istius-raldor-praix-novmir-praok-norir-holok